Assessing Your Power Needs and Usage



How do you identify your power requires before setting up a planetary system? Begin by examining your previous electrical power costs.

Look for your regular monthly usage in kilowatt-hours (kWh) over the last year; this'll provide you a solid average. Next, think about any type of changes you intend to make, like including brand-new home appliances or an electrical vehicle, as these will certainly impact your future energy demands.

You must likewise assess the effectiveness of your home-- bad insulation or old appliances can increase energy consumption.



Finally, consider your way of life habits; for instance, if you're typically home during the day, you could need a bigger system to cover daytime use.

Comprehending Various Kinds Of Solar Equipments



After evaluating your power needs, it is very important to discover the numerous types of solar systems readily available.

You'll generally come across three major choices: grid-tied, off-grid, and crossbreed systems. Grid-tied systems link directly to the energy grid, enabling you to sell excess power back. They're commonly one of the most economical selection if you have trusted grid accessibility.

Hybrid systems integrate both, offering you the adaptability of battery storage space while still linking to the grid. Each type has its benefits, so consider your way of living, place, and power objectives when making your option.
